Greetings, I am coming across an issue with logging in whose pattern has eluded 
me thus far. I have an admin account and two standard user accounts on a 
Windows 7 computer running SP1.
 
>From time to time after pressing enter on one of the accounts while in the 
>password field, Window-Eyes will echo the characters that are being typed in 
>the password field.
 
Pressing the tab key to the OK button, then shift+tab to get back into the 
password field gets around this issue.
